A face mask has been a daily necessity for Koreans living under heavy air pollution, even before the outbreak of Covid. After checking the air pollution forecast in the morning, people went out wearing masks hanging on the wall. However, people often forget that the face mask itself is composed of microplastics, which are fatal for our respiratory organs as much as micro-dust does.
In this conceptual art piece, Tillandsia and natural wood(*assumption) are substituted for a mask filter, made of chemical materials; The title implies that TS stands for Tillandsia and 95 represents how much pollution can filter. Tillandsia, an aerial plant surviving without roots, functions as a natural air purifier. Also, it lives in diverse environments from rainforests to deserts according to the species. This characteristic of Tillandsia will enable them to survive in extreme environments and temperatures in the future.
